1.Risk factors of hepatocellular carcinoma in patients with HBV-related liver cirrhosis receiving nucleos (t) ide analogues treatment
Liuqing YANG ; Guoli LIN ; Yuankai WU ; Xiangyong LI ; Tingting XIONG ; Zhiliang GAO ; Yutian CHONG
Chinese Journal of Clinical Infectious Diseases 2012;05(1):28-32
Objective To survey the incidence of hepatocellular carcinoma (HCC) in patients with HBV-related cirrhosis receiving nucleos(t)ide analogues treatment and to assess its risk factors.Methods A total of 141 patients with HBV-related liver cirrhosis receiving nucleos(t) ide therapy from April 2008 to June 2011 were enrolled.The clinical data including virological and biochemical tests were retrospectively analyzed.Univariate and multivariate Cox proportional hazards regression model was used to identify the risk factors of HCC occurrence.Results Patients were followed up for 6.4 to 87.6 months with a median followup time of 32.5 months.During the follow-up period,15 out of 141 patients developed HCC with an average annual incidence rate of 3.8%.HCC incidence was higher in HBeAg positive cirrhosis and in those with family history of liver cancer ( RR =4.524 and 3.858,P < 0.05 ).Conclusions Patients with HBV-related cirrhosis have a high incidence rate of HCC even they recieve nucleos (t) ide analogues treatment.HBeAg positive cirrhosis and family history of liver cancer are independent risk factors for HCC.
2.Extended hepatectomy with hepatic artery resection in obstructive jaundice rats
Bin LI ; Youlei ZHANG ; Dong LI ; Yiliang ZHANG ; Chunfang GAO ; Qiangzhi XU ; Cantong NI ; Yuankai HOU ; Yi WANG
Chinese Journal of General Surgery 2008;23(11):872-876
Objective To study liver function, hepatic energy metabolism, regeneration and apoptosis in obstructive jaundiced or normal liver after 70% partial hepatectomy (PH) with hepatic artery resection (HAR) in rats. Methods In this study, 133 male SD rats were enrolled, 6 rats were in sham operation group, 20 rats underwent choledochoduodenostomy after 70% PH and 20 rats did 70%- PH, choledochoduodenostomy plus HAR. The remaining 87 rats 5 days after common bile duct ligation (CBDL) were randomized into two groups: 70% PH with choledochoduodenostomy, and 70% PH with choledochoduodenustomy plus HAR. Serum TB, ALT, ALB and ALP; tissue of hepatic HGF, bcl-2 mRNA and protein expression; ATP, ADP and AMP in hepatic tissues; hepatocyte proliferation/ apoptosis index were observed postoperatively (24 h, 72 h and 7 d). MortaLity was calculated. Results Rats without obstructive jaundice could tolerate 70% PH plus HAR with good liver regeneration. Compared with other groups, the serum liver function index; ATP content and EC value; HGF,bcl-2 mRNA content of liver tissue and the hepatocyte proliferation/apoptosis index in 70% PH with HAR group significantly aggravated and the mortality signiticanfly increased in obstructive jaundice rats ( P < 0. 05). Conclusions (1) The liver regeneration and apoptosis were not significantly influenced in normal mrs undergoing 70% PH and 70% PH with HAR, moreover hepatoeyte energy metabolism and liver function recovered rapidly in both groups. (2) With the existence of severe bilirubinemia, 70% PH with HAR caused an increased mortality suggesting a rationale for a preoperative bilirubin reducing procedures before a major surgery in malignant obstructive jaundice.
3.Venous thromboembolism risk and prophylaxis status of cancer inpatient
Ruihua XU ; Yuankai SHI ; Yuan GAO ; Weimin LI ; Xinyu QIN ; Jieming QU ; Zhenguo ZHAI ; Chen WANG
Chinese Journal of Oncology 2021;43(10):1100-1104
Objective:To determine the risk profile of venous thromboembolism (VTE) and evaluate VTE prophylaxis implementation of the hospitalized cancer patients in the DissolVE 2 study.Methods:The data of hospitalized cancer patients in the DissolVE 2 study were analyzed. The risk distribution of VTE, preventive measures and in-hospital VTE events of hospitalized patients with tumors were described by percentage and 95% confident interval (CI).Results:A total of 1 535 cancer patients were included. According to the Padua score, 826 (53.8%) patients were at low risk of VTE, while 709 (46.2%) patients were at high VTE risk. VTE events occurred in 4 low-risk patients (0.5%; 95% CI: 0.1%, 1.2%) and 5 high-risk patients (0.7%; 95% CI: 0.2%, 1.6%). The overall incidence was 0.6% (9/1 535, 95% CI: 0.3%, 1.1%). Among patients with high VTE risk, 666 (93.9%) did not receive any VTE prophylaxis, and only 11 (1.6%) patients received appropriate VTE prophylaxis. Among patients who received VTE prevention, no VTE event was observed. Conclusions:Nearly half of the hospitalized cancer patients are at high risk of VTE, but most of them don′t receive VTE prophylaxis. The results reflect the insufficient management of VTE risk for hospitalized cancer patients in China, and improvement of awareness and practice of VTE prophylaxis is urgently needed.

5.The outcome and safety of neoadjuvant PD-1 blockade plus chemotherapy in stage Ⅱ~Ⅲ non-small cell lung cancer
Yutao LIU ; Yushun GAO ; Yousheng MAO ; Jun JIANG ; Lin YANG ; Jianliang YANG ; Xingsheng HU ; Shengyu ZHOU ; Yan QIN ; Yuankai SHI
Chinese Journal of Oncology 2020;42(6):480-485
Objective:To explore the safety and therapeutic effect of programmed death 1 (PD-1) antibody combined with chemotherapy as a neoadjuvant therapy for patients with stage Ⅱ to Ⅲ non-small cell lung cancer (NSCLC).Methods:Thirteen patients, who had been diagnosed as stage Ⅱ-Ⅲ NSCLC and received PD-1 inhibitor plus chemotherapy as a neoadjuvant treatment in National Cancer Center/Cancer Hospital were recruited. The patients received consecutive neoadjuvant chemotherapy for 21 days as a cycle and the therapeutic efficacy was evaluated after two cycles.Results:At the last time of follow-up on December 2, 2019, the objective response rate (ORR) and disease control rate (DCR) of these patients were 61.5% (95% CI 30.9%-92.1%) and 100%, respectively. The downregulation rate of disease stage was 61.5% (8/13). The resectable rate was 38.5% (5/13), among them, the major pathologic response (MPR) was 60.0% (3/5) and the complete pathologic response (CPR) was 20.0% (1/5). The neoadjuvant chemotherapy displayed a low incidence of adverse reaction. The main grade 3 to 4 toxicities were neutropenia (38.5%) and leukopenia (23.1%). There was no significant immune-related toxicity. The safety and tolerability of perioperative period of patients underwent resection were promising. Conclusions:Immunotherapy combined with chemotherapy as a neoadjuvant treatment is an effective, low-toxicity treatment manner, which has perioperative safety and high rate of MPR for patients with resectable NSCLC. It is a promising treatment option for patients with stage Ⅱ to Ⅲ NSCLC.

7.Exploring the mechanism and treatment principles of testicular radiation injury from the perspective of "the struggle between vital qi and pathogen" theory
Xiaoying CHEN ; An WANG ; Yifan YE ; Yan WANG ; Yuankai GAO ; Qing XU ; Shuran WANG ; Zhangdi ZHAO ; Sumin HU
Journal of Beijing University of Traditional Chinese Medicine 2025;48(3):379-385
Testicular radiation injury is a structural and functional abnormality of the testes caused directly or indirectly by radiation, which disrupts spermatogenesis and compromises male fertility. The development of effective preventive and therapeutic interventions is essential because of the high prevalence of this condition in clinical settings and its profound effect on patients′ reproductive health and overall well-being. The concept of "the struggle between vital qi and pathogen" is first seen in the Treatise on Cold Pathogenic Diseases. It denotes the dynamic struggle between vital and pathogenic qi. The occurrence, development, and sequelae of all diseases reflect this ongoing conflict. In this context, this study defines the "vital qi" of the testis as its capacity to generate and preserve the essence of reproduction and to resist damage. The pathogenic qi associated with testicular radiation injury is categorized into two types: ionizing poison and retaining evil. The pathogenesis of testicular radiation damage is delineated into three stages by integrating the characteristics of vital and pathogenic qi: the injury, adhesion, and recovery phases. Based on the theoretical framework advanced by this study, the therapeutic approach for testicular radiation injury should adhere to the fundamental principle of strengthening vital qi and eliminating pathogenic factors. Although the primary focus of treatment should be on strengthening vital qi, it should also be complemented by strategies to eliminate pathogenic influences. This paper aims to provide a novel perspective and strategic approach to the traditional Chinese medicine diagnosis, prevention, and treatment of testicular radiation injury. By elucidating the process of testicular radiation injury and its corresponding treatment principles, it seeks to offer valuable insights for clinical practice.
8.MUC16: The Novel Target for Tumor Therapy.
Ruyun GAO ; Ning LOU ; Xiaohong HAN ; Yuankai SHI
Chinese Journal of Lung Cancer 2022;25(7):452-459
Mucin16 (MUC16), also known as carbohydrate antigen 125 (CA125), is a glycoprotein antigen that can be recognized by the monoclonal antibody OC125 detected from epithelial ovarian carcinoma antigen by Bast et al in 1981. CA125 is not present in normal ovarian tissue but is usually elevated in the serum of epithelial ovarian carcinoma patients. CA125 is the most commonly used serologic biomarker for the diagnosis and recurrence monitoring of epithelial ovarian carcinoma. MUC16 is highly expressed in varieties of tumors. MUC16 can interact with galectin-1/3, mesothelin, sialic acid-binding immunoglobulin-type lectins-9 (Siglec-9), and other ligands. MUC16 plays an important role in tumor genesis, proliferation, migration, invasion, and tumor immunity through various signaling pathways. Besides, therapies targeting MUC16 have some significant achievements. Related preclinical studies and clinical trials are in progress. MUC16 may be a potential novel target for tumor therapy. This article will review the mechanism of MUC16 in tumor genesis and progression, and focus on the research actuality of MUC16 in tumor therapy. This article also provides references for subsequent tumor therapy studies targeting MUC16.
